Abstract

The research objectives are exploring characteristics of human mobility patterns, subsequently modelling them mathematically depending on inter-event time ∆t and traveled distances ∆rparameters using CDRs (Call Detailed Records). The observations are obtained from Armada festival in France. Understanding, modelling and simulating human mobility among urban regions is excitement approach, due to itsimportance in rescue situations for various events either indoor events like evacuation of buildings or outdoor ones like public assemblies,community evacuation in casesemerged during emergency situations, moreover serves urban planning and smart cities. The results of numerical simulation are consistent withpreviousinvestigations findings in that real systems patterns are almost follow an exponential distribution.Further experimentations could classify mobility patterns into major classes (work or off) days, also radius of gyration could be considered as influential parameter in modelling human mobility, additionally city rhythm could be extracted by modelling mobility speed of individuals
